Assessing the Damage: First Steps 🧐🔍
The first thing you need to do when your motherboard gets wet is to act quickly. Here’s a step-by-step guide to assess the damage:
- Unplug Everything: Immediately unplug your power supply and all other cables. This prevents any further damage and reduces the risk of short circuits. ⚡🚫
- Remove the Battery: If your motherboard has a CMOS battery, remove it to cut off any residual power. 📦🔋
- Inspect for Moisture: Carefully inspect the motherboard for any visible signs of water. Look for droplets, damp spots, or corrosion. 🕵️♂️💧
- Dry It Out: Use a soft, lint-free cloth to gently pat dry the motherboard. Avoid rubbing as it can spread the moisture. 🧽💨
